Milwaukee Area Technical College offers an Associate of Applied Science degree in Anesthesia Technology. The program starts each August at the downtown campus in Milwaukee, Wisconsin. This is a two-year program that includes both classroom work and clinical experience in an actual hospital setting. Upon completion of this program, each graduate has the option to test with the American Society of Anesthesia Technologists & Technicians (ASATT) to become a Certified Anesthesia Technician.

The Sanford Brown Institute offers an Associate of Applied Science Degree Program in Anesthesia Technology at the Houston Campus. This is a two-year program that includes classroom work, as well as laboratory and clinical experience.

The campus in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, also offers an associate's degree program. This location offers an Associate of Specialized Technology Degree Program in Anesthesia Technology.

Sanford Brown Institute offers a Certificate Program in Anesthesia Technology at the Inselin, New Jersey, campus. This is a 72-week program. In addition to classwork, the student must also complete a clinical externship.

Stony Brook University in Stony Brook, New York, offers a Bachelor of Science degree in Health Sciences with a clinical concentration as an Anesthesia Technologist. This is a four-year program.
